Britain has introduced new anti-russian sanctions in response to the forced deportation of Ukrainian children

The United Kingdom has implemented new anti-russian sanctions in response to the forced deportation of Ukrainian children. 

This is stated on the official website of the UK government. 

The sanctions target, in particular, the Child Rights Ombudsman of the moscow Oblast, Ksenia Mishonova, as well as the Minister of Education of the russian federation, Sergey Kravtsov. The sanctions also apply to russian propagandists. Among them is former Russia Today host Anton Krasovsky, who openly called for drowning and burning Ukrainian children on live television.

According to the UK government, more than 19,000 Ukrainian children have been forcibly deported to russia or deeper into temporarily occupied territories. Many of the deported children are being relocated for "re-education" in Crimea, where they are subjected to a russian-oriented academic, cultural, patriotic, and military education.

In total, since the onset of the full-scale war, over 1,600 individuals and legal entities from the russian federation have fallen under UK sanctions, including 29 banks with global assets of £1 trillion (about $1.3 trillion) and over 130 oligarchs with a combined wealth of over £145 billion (almost $190 billion).
